Description
**Describe the problem you have/What new integration you would like**
Integrating the following work with esphome: https://github.com/jorgenkraghjakobsen/snapclient
**Please describe your use case for this integration and alternatives you've tried:**
Create a free software, cheap sonos clone for multi-room audio.
**Additional context**
I would like to have a system that is as energy-efficient as possible, I think the esp32 might be suitable for this. Ideally, the workflow would be the following:
Materials needed:
1. ESP32
2. MA12070P or similar
3. Analog speakers
4. (battery if you want) power supply
Software needed: Snapcast server
Ideally, I would like the installation process to be as simple as soldering together the modules, specify it in the config, and flash, then have it pop in homeassistant.
A possible alternative would be to use separate bluetooth speakers. I am not sure how feasible this would be?
